Barnes & Noble Hosts the World’s Largest Costume Party

More Than 700 Barnes & Noble Stores Nationwide to Host Midnight Magic Costume Parties on July 20 to Celebrate the Publication of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ows

NEW YORK, NEW YORK – June 20, 2007 – Barnes & Noble, Inc. (NYSE: BKS), the world’s largest bookseller, today announced that more than 700 Barnes & Noble stores across the country will host “Midnight Magic Costume Parties” on Friday, July 20. Stores will remain open late and sell the seventh and final book in J.K. Rowling’s Harry Potter series,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ows, at the stroke of midnight, when it officially goes on sale.

Barnes & Noble welcomes Harry Potter fans to come dressed as their favorite Harry Potter characters and enjoy a magical evening filled with enchanting activities, spellbinding prizes, photo opportunities, unique items for sale and the chance to be among the first to take Harry home.  To find the Midnight Magic Costume Party near you, please visit www.bn.com/midnightmagic.

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ows will sell for $20.99, 40 percent off the list price of $34.99.  Barnes & Noble Members can buy the book for $18.89, a savings of 46 percent.  The compact disc and audiocassettes for the unabridged book will also be available.  Customers can order the book at any Barnes & Noble store or online at Barnes & Noble.com (www.bn.com).
